News: The National Agency for Science and Engineering Infrastructure (NASENI) to Create 5,000 Jobs

The Jigawa State Government and National Agency for Science and Engineering Infrastructure (NASENI) are currently working out plans on kick-starting real- time industrial development of the State with NASENI's deployment of locally developed technologies in the areas of Solar energy for rural electrification, integrated cassava processing facilities for rural agriculture reforms,hydro power technologies and resuscitation of educational sector with massive supply of NASENI science kits to both primary and secondary schools in the state amongst others.

The Executive Vice Chairman/CEO of NASENI, Engr. Professor Mohammed Sani Harunaand top management staff of the Agency,at the weekend, held a meeting with the Executive Governor of Jigawa State, Alhaji Mohammed Badaru Abubakar, the State Commissioners,Permanent Secretaries in the State Ministries at the Jigawa State Government House, Dutse, the state capital.

Recall in September, 2015, President Muhammadu Buhari directed NASENI to explore ways of converting all its technology products, innovations, machines and equipment developed by the Agency to achieve industrial revolutionfor the country.

The President, who is also Chairman of Governing Board of NASENI specifically, directed the management of the Agency to seek areas of collaboration with State Governors, Ministries, Departments and Agencies (MDAs) to ensure that NASENI’s technology products and engineering infrastructure facilities are utilized for the socio-economic transformation of the Nigeria economy.

Governor Abubakar said at the weekend that Jigawa state’s doors are all open to NASENI interventions including all forms of technical cooperation between the Agency and the State in line with the presidential directive. The Governor at take-off specifically requested jigawa State Metropolis’ street lights to henceforth be powered by NASENI solar energy systems.The Governor believed that Solar energy will be cheaper than running the street lights currently on diesel generators.

The State government also asked NASENI to intervene in the upgrade of the State’s Agriculture processing plants scattered across the state including supply of science equipment and other science teaching aids to catch young pupils in Jigawa to become interested in science subjects.

Governor Abubakar said at the meeting his administration was more interested in investments in infrastructure facilities that would aid Jigawa State citizens to develop entrepreneurial orientation and cultivate the spirit of using science and technology innovations to tackle the socio-economic problems of the state.

The Governor added that he was aware that a genuine utilisation of science and technology resource was the only solution to assist the government create numerous job opportunities for the teaming youths of Jigawa State and also guarantee wealth creation for the people in general and by extension the nation at large. Therefore, he re-emphasised the State’s commitment to work with NASENI in all identified areas which he believed would lead to industrialisation of the State.

NASENI and Jigawa State would work together in several areas amongst which are: deployment of Advanced Manufacturing Technology in State’s industries,Solar Energy infrastructure development,Small Hydro turbines technology development, deployment of Science educational equipment, Agricultural machines and equipment manufacturing and deployment including transportation etc.Professor Haruna disclosed that all the aforementioned technologies and technical know-how have been perfected in the NASENI system.

The EVC/CE NASENI remarked that coincidentally,Jigawa State was the first state in the country to respond to the industrialisation tasks handed down to NASENI by President Muhammadu Buhari. Also the NASENI boss said he was amazed at the level of awareness demonstrated by the governor of Jigawa State about the potentials of utilizing science and technology resource to modernize the socio-economic activities of any society especially in alleviation of poverty.

NASENI he reaffirmed would, in collaboration with all its local and foreign partners, see to the actualisation of the dreams of improved socio-economic lives for the people of Jigawa by the Executive Governor using technology and that of Mr. President for the rest of the States in Nigeria respectively.
